## Validation and display
|
||||
|
||||
Every numeric input is validated independently and an offending one gets
|
||||
a red border and a hover/tap tooltip with the reason: no value may be
|
||||
negative, the five blocks follow the engine value rules
|
||||
(`pkg/calc/validator.go`, surfaced per-field by
|
||||
`shipClassFieldErrors`), and a custom load may not exceed cargo capacity.
|
||||
|
||||
Every displayed number — the derived results and the goal-seek
|
||||
back-solved input — is rounded **up** to three decimals through the
|
||||
shared `pkg/calc/number.go.Ceil3` (bridged as `core.ceil3`), so a value
|
||||
is never shown lower than it is (a speed of 5.0003 reads 5.001). The
|
||||
engine keeps its own round-to-nearest `util.Fixed*`; `Ceil3` is a
|
||||
display-only helper that lives in `pkg/calc` so the UI and Go share one
|
||||
implementation.
